NC machining simulative technology can simulate the real machining process by computer. The results of machining could be displayed in many ways with this technology. It has been widely used in NC machaine designing, NC teaching, NC system debugging and CAM. Currently, many NC machining simulative systems are lack of realistic sense. Aiming at this situation, a high realistic NC machining simulation system is researched in this thesis using virtual reality(VR) technology. The machining simulative system is developed in four steps, overall design, software achievement, hardware system setting up and whole system debugging.In order to simply the system development, the whole system was divided into five functional parts after analyzing the demands of the NC machining simulative system. All parts were successfully developed. Aiming at different applications, some kinds of 3D display systems were designed. Finally, a high realistic NC machining simulative system based on VR technology has been established.1) Overall designAt the stage of overall design, the following works have been finished. Firstly, the system development idea was summarized based on analysis of the NC simulative system demands. Sconedly, a suitable software development platform was selected which contents VS2008, Vega Prime5.0, GLstudio4.5.1 and GLstudiofor VP5. At last, modular developing process has been put forward.2) Software developmentThere are four steps need to be completed at the stage of software achievement. Firstly, a suitable method to modeling the NC machine has been found after compared multiple ways of model transformation and simplification. NC machine VR model was built successfully with this method. Sconedly, a control system was built so that the NC machine could be controlled in three ways. The first one is controlling the NC machine by calling NC codes stored in an external text. The sconed one is controlling through operating the NC panel. The last method to control the machine demands operators to input the NC codes through the keyboard on the panel. Thirdly, some interactive functions including the operational NC panel were designed to support the users to use the control system. Fourthly, an easily implemented cutting algorithm based on the selected software platform was designed. The machining simulative workpiece was modeled in the method of planar discretization.3) Hardware system setting upAt the stage of hardware system setting up, 3D display systems of NC machining simulative system based on VR technology was established combined with the VR hardware including HMD(Head Mounted Display), Stereographic projection equipment and Crystal Eye stereo glasses.4) Hardware and software debuggingAt the last stage, the whole system including software system and hardware system has been test.
